As a neutral, third party advertiser, our company does not make any guarantees regarding the contractors in our network beyond the fact that they have successfully passed the background screening required to become a subscriber to our advertising services. While we actively discourage the members of...

our network from subcontracting on projects that were acquired through our site, we do not have the ability to control their business decisions and cannot be held responsible for the results thereof, especially in regards to work quality or pricing disputes. We have advised this consumer that should they have an ongoing concern related to their situation with the contractor in question that their best course of action will be to pursue to contractor directly through an outside resource such as small claims court. The contractor is no longer a member of our network, and we do not have any regulatory authority to force the refund that this consumer is demanding from them.
